What Can You Expect in Assisted Living?

Assisted living facilities offer a wide range of services focused on ensuring comfort, safety, and well-being. Here are some commonly provided services:

Personal Care Services:

  • Support with activities of daily living (ADLs) like bathing, dressing, grooming, and eating.
  • Management and administration of medications.
  • Assistance with incontinence needs.
  • Aid with mobility and movement.

Health and Wellness:

  • Health assessments
  • On-site availability of physical, occupational, and speech therapy.
  • Convenient access to medical services, either on-site or through transportation to appointments.
  • Exercise and wellness programs.
  • Specialized care for residents with specific health conditions, including dementia or diabetes.

Dining Services:

  • Meals
  • Dietary accommodations for residents with specific needs or restrictions.

Housekeeping and Maintenance:

  • Regular cleaning and laundry services.
  • Ensure the upkeep of personal living spaces and common areas.

Social and Recreational Activities:

  • Helping residents stay engaged with a diverse range of social, cultural, and recreational activities.
  • Common areas for socializing including lounges, libraries, game rooms, and gardens.
  • Outings and excursions to local attractions, events, and shopping destinations.

Safety and Security Features:

  • 24-hour staff presence
  • Secure entrances and exits to prevent wandering in residents with dementia.
  • Emergency call systems 

Accommodation Options:

  • Single or double rooms, studios, and one-bedroom apartments are all common.
  • Flexible options for furnished or unfurnished spaces.

Average Cost of Assisted Living

Assisted living costs vary based on care needs and staff ratio. Payment options include a la carte or all-inclusive plans, each with pros and cons. Watch for hidden fees and consider the impact of luxury amenities and location on pricing.

The national average cost of assisted living is just over $4,500 per month. The average monthly cost in Houston, Texas is a bit higher at $5,200.

What Can You Expect in a Nursing Home?

Seniors in nursing homes receive regular health assessments, personalized care plans, and 24-hour emergency care. Other services and amenities typically include housekeeping, meals (including special diets), medical care by trained professionals, medication management, help with daily activities, various activities, emergency call systems, exercise programs, transportation, and social events.

Average Cost of Nursing Homes

In the US, the monthly cost for a semi-private room in a nursing home is $7,908, while a private room carries a price tag of $9,034. These expenses can vary based on factors like the nursing home's location, the level of care provided, and the amenities available at a particular facility.

If we take a closer look at Houston, the costs of nursing home care are just a bit different from the national average.  In Houston, a semi-private room averages $5,718 per month, and a private room averages $7,604.

Retirement Communities and Senior Apartments in Houston

Active and independent retirees over 55 in Houston can find a vibrant lifestyle in the city's many retirement communities. These communities offer a variety of housing options, ranging from independent living apartments and townhomes to patio homes for those who prefer a single-story layout.

Beyond comfortable living spaces, Houston's retirement communities foster a strong sense of community. Residents enjoy social clubs, group activities, and frequent neighborly interactions. Amenities often include swimming pools, fitness centers, walking trails, and community centers that host events and gatherings.

For retirees seeking a more urban experience, Houston offers a wealth of senior apartments in walkable neighborhoods. These age-restricted communities provide convenience and a strong sense of community, freeing residents from yard work and home maintenance. This allows them to focus on enjoying Houston's cultural attractions and diverse social scene.

Average Cost of Retirement Communities and Senior Apartments

For active and independent seniors in Houston, independent living within their own homes or with in-home care services is a popular option. The cost can vary significantly, ranging from around $1,500 to $3,000 per month, with retirement communities typically falling on the higher end.

Senior Adult Day Care Services Near Houston

Houston's adult day care services prioritize not only physical well-being but also foster social bonds, combatting isolation with engaging events and group activities. Additionally, these centers in Houston can offer valuable respite for family caregivers!

What Can You Expect from Adult Day Care?

More than just supervision, adult day care programs are vibrant hubs offering everything from fun group games and delicious meals to specialized therapies and exercise programs. Think medication management, gentle yoga, and holiday celebrations, all wrapped up in a supportive and social environment designed to enrich the lives of both participants and their families. Many adult day care centers even provide extra convenience by transporting participants to and from the center.

Average Cost of Senior Adult Day Care

Adult day cares and other adult day health services provide a range of amazing benefits! From assistance with daily activities (ADLs) to socializing, exercise, convenient transportation, and even light health monitoring. Some programs go above and beyond to help care for certain health conditions. The costs can vary, but the average cost of adult day care in Houston is $65 per day.

Home Care in Houston

Many older adults prefer to age in their own homes. Home health care in Houston can assist them. These services allow individuals to access various medical and non-clinical services in their familiar surroundings, eliminating the need to relocate to a facility. From administering medications to daily living support like housekeeping, Houston's home health care enables seniors to sustain their independence while getting essential care.

What Types of Services Does Home Care Provide?

Senior home care provides a variety of services. Here are some of the main types provided:

  • Short-term Nursing
  • Physical, Occupational, and Speech Therapy
  • Home Health Aide Services: Home health aides assist with daily tasks like bathing, dressing, and meal preparation. They can also monitor vital signs under the supervision of a health professional.
  • Homemaking Services: Basic household tasks like laundry, grocery shopping, meal prep, and light housekeeping.
  • Companionship Services: Companions provide engaging conversations, participate in hobbies, and accompany seniors on errands or appointments.
  • Specialized Care

Average Cost of Home Care in Houston

The national average cost of home care is just over $5,000 per month. Though the actual cost will vary depending on needs and whether a service or independent caregiver is employed, the average monthly cost in Houston is $4,900.
